How they compare
Netherlands (Kingdom of the) currently reports 322,054 m3 against 20,400 m3 in Democratic People's Republic of Korea, a difference of 301,654 m3.
That makes Netherlands (Kingdom of the)'s figure about 15.8 times Democratic People's Republic of Korea's.
Across all 30 years both countries report, Netherlands (Kingdom of the) has been ahead every year.
Democratic People's Republic of Korea ranks 2nd and Netherlands (Kingdom of the) ranks 5th of 16 countries.
Netherlands (Kingdom of the) has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Democratic People's Republic of Korea | Netherlands (Kingdom of the) |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 30,041 m3 | 195,360 m3 | 165,319 m3 | Netherlands (Kingdom of the) |
| 2000s | 21,730 m3 | 363,966 m3 | 342,236 m3 | Netherlands (Kingdom of the) |
| 2010s | 20,400 m3 | 306,056 m3 | 285,656 m3 | Netherlands (Kingdom of the) |
| 2020s | 20,400 m3 | 297,091 m3 | 276,691 m3 | Netherlands (Kingdom of the) |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
